 | Paeony lactiflora Flame Grace your garden with this medium size paeony with brilliant red flowers. Blooms with dense flowerheads and will produce increasingly more stems with bold beautiful blooms over the years to come. Paeonies are renowned for there beauty and are one of the best cutflowers for in bouquets. Great for the border, but also for large planters or tubs (an old keg or barrel would be ideal). Cutflowers from June until July. Suitable for Rocky Gardens. Hardy. Prefers Well Drained Soil and a Sunny position. Full grown size 80 - 100 cm....more

Rockdust is all about re-mineralisation of soil and that quite simply means putting the minerals (initially left on the ground by the last ice age 420 million years ago) back into your soil. Rockdust is powderised volcanic rock.
Rockdust equivalents have only been sourced in a few places around the world - Latvia, Washington state USA, Austria and now right here in Scotland. It contains a vast amount of trace elements and minerals and this can help your garden (just as the last ice age left left behind mineral rich soil) in numerous ways.
Rockdust has beenextensively tested and is 100% organic. Rockdust is certified by the Scottish Organic Producers Association and the Organic Farmers and Growers.

For application:
Rockdust can be used at any time of the year
Simply sprinkle Rockdust evenly over an appropriate area to be planted as you would bone-meal
For lawns and in flower and vegetable gardens spread evenly and rake in. (Please contact mailto:store@thegardenfactory.co.uk if you are interested in the 20kg bags). 0.5kg of Rockdust should cover one square metre, 20kg - 40 square metres. If your soil is poor simply increase the quantities by up to 5kg per square metre.
Can be added with other soil conditioners, multipurpose compost or plant foods
As a composting agent, to speed up the composting process for healthier compost, add 3-5mm over the surface of each layer of green waste
